Word Count Wednesday & Last Day Before NaNo

Posted on 09:40 by Unknown
Well, no big shock here, but my word count was zero again this week.  But I'm fully expecting that to change by next Wednesday because I signed up for NaNoWriMo.  For those of you who aren't able to participate in NaNo, I'd still like to do fun Word Count Wednesday stuff as we set personal goals to reach in the month of November.  When I did the JumpStartWriMo over the summer, I found it so motivating to be going through it with you guys.

So, it's the last day before NaNo and what have I done to prepare?  Sadly, nothing.  I had all these pie in the sky dreams that I would outline and research and be totally ready to jump in.  But, instead, I made a Wendy and Peter Pan costume from scratch.  And my back hurts from sewing.  Hopefully it will all be worth it tonight.  I'm also a teeny bit worried because I'm sick with a horrible cough and cold.  But I can power through, right?  Send all your good chicken noodle soup thoughts my way, okay?

So, are you ready to write in November?  Are you setting your own writing goals if you're not officially participating in NaNo?  How did you do this week?
